11/21 or 9/17 can be equaled by multiplying the caller.

so 11/21 becomes: 17*11 and 17*21= 187/357

and 9/17 becomes: 21*9 and 21*17= 189/357

As can be seen 189/357 > 187/357.

So 9/17 > 11/21
